Key Responsibilities

  • Partner with the Beverage EUM Leader to define the 'where to play' and 'how to win' strategy for the beverage business across key subcategories and channels.
  • Lead initiatives aimed at expanding Kerry's footprint as a leading flavor and taste partner across all beverage segments.
  • Engage directly with senior-level marketers and R&D leaders at top beverage brands and co-manufacturers to build trusted partnerships, articulate Kerry's unique value, and shape collaborative innovation.
  • Champion differentiated, market-ready value propositions-brought to life through compelling beverage concepts in application-that directly support commercial growth and align with priority taste platforms.
  • Equip the sales organization with powerful go-to-market tools, trend insights, concept portfolios, and tailored presentations that accelerate pipeline development and commercial conversion.
  • Build a deep understanding of consumer trends, emerging beverage formats, competitor strategies, and white space opportunities to inform strategic planning and external positioning.
  • Collaborate with R&D, Applications, and Technology teams to develop 'collections' of taste-forward, trend-aligned beverage concepts that resonate in-market and reflect Kerry's full capabilities.
  • Lead alignment across marketing, sales, R&D, insights, and communications to ensure a unified go-to-market approach.
  • Brief central marketing partners on campaigns that showcase Kerry's leadership in flavor, aligned with the beverage strategy and portfolio collections.
  • Coach and develop a team of high-performing marketers; foster a culture of curiosity, agility, and accountability.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Business, Food Science, or related field; MBA or advanced degree preferred.
  • 12+ years of progressive marketing or commercial Beverage experience at a peer flavor company.
  • Proven track record of creating a strategic vision, driving commercial execution against the vision and delivering measurable business growth.
  • Strong people leader with experience managing, developing, and motivating high-performance teams.
  • Highly collaborative, with demonstrated success leading within matrixed organizations.
  • Dynamic presenter and storyteller with the ability to influence senior-level stakeholders both internally and externally.
  • Strong business acumen, project management skills, and ability to balance long-term vision with near-term execution.
  • Willingness to travel up to 30% for customer meetings, industry events, and team collaboration.
